Do you find that it becomes harder to concentrate as you get older? Do you sometimes feel like your brain is foggy? If so, you're not alone. Many women experience changes in their ability to focus during the menopause. This can be a difficult time for both our personal and professional lives. But did you know that this can also affect our ability to train dogs? In this podcast and blog post, Expert Mandi Everson chats to LWDG Founder Jo Perrott about how perimenopause and menopause can affect dog training and offers tips on concentrating when you're going through changes.
